The pozzolan market in Australia is growing as the construction industry seeks sustainable cement additives to enhance concrete durability and reduce carbon emissions. Pozzolans, including fly ash, silica fume, and natural volcanic ash, improve concrete strength and resistance to chemical attacks. The increasing focus on green building materials is driving demand for pozzolanic cement solutions. However, fluctuations in the availability of industrial by-products like fly ash may impact market supply.
As sustainability becomes a priority in the construction sector, the use of pozzolan as a cement additive has gained traction. Its ability to enhance durability, reduce carbon emissions, and lower the overall cost of cement production has driven its adoption. Infrastructure projects focusing on green building materials have further boosted the market.
Australias pozzolan market faces challenges related to limited local availability and competition from traditional cement additives. Natural pozzolans are not abundantly found in Australia, leading to reliance on imports, which increases costs. Additionally, the dominance of conventional cement materials slows the adoption of pozzolans, despite their environmental benefits.
